pub struct LedgerHeader {Show 15 fields
pub ledgerVersion: uint32,
pub previousLedgerHash: Hash,
pub scpValue: StellarValue,
pub txSetResultHash: Hash,
pub bucketListHash: Hash,
pub ledgerSeq: uint32,
pub totalCoins: int64,
pub feePool: int64,
pub inflationSeq: uint32,
pub idPool: uint64,
pub baseFee: uint32,
pub baseReserve: uint32,
pub maxTxSetSize: uint32,
pub skipList: [Hash; 4],
pub ext: LedgerHeaderExt,
}
Fields§
§ledgerVersion: uint32
§previousLedgerHash: Hash
§scpValue: StellarValue
§txSetResultHash: Hash
§bucketListHash: Hash
§ledgerSeq: uint32
§totalCoins: int64
§feePool: int64
§inflationSeq: uint32
§idPool: uint64
§baseFee: uint32
§baseReserve: uint32
§maxTxSetSize: uint32
§skipList: [Hash; 4]
§ext: LedgerHeaderExt
Trait Implementations§
Source§impl Clone for LedgerHeader
impl Clone for LedgerHeader
Source§fn clone(&self) -> LedgerHeader
fn clone(&self) -> LedgerHeader
Returns a copy of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for LedgerHeader
impl Debug for LedgerHeader
Source§impl<Out: Write> Pack<Out> for LedgerHeader
impl<Out: Write> Pack<Out> for LedgerHeader
Source§impl PartialEq for LedgerHeader
impl PartialEq for LedgerHeader
Source§impl<In: Read> Unpack<In> for LedgerHeader
impl<In: Read> Unpack<In> for LedgerHeader
impl Eq for LedgerHeader
impl StructuralPartialEq for LedgerHeader
Auto Trait Implementations§
impl Freeze for LedgerHeader
impl RefUnwindSafe for LedgerHeader
impl Send for LedgerHeader
impl Sync for LedgerHeader
impl Unpin for LedgerHeader
impl UnwindSafe for LedgerHeader
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more